Afficher plus [+] Moins [-]anglais. Effects of vase solutions on the vase life and physiological parameters of four cut flowers, chrysanthemum, carnation, rose and gladiolus, were investigated. The physiological parameters included the content of the reducing sugar, soluble protein and malondialdehyde content in the petals. The results showed that with time going on, the reducing sugar content and soluble protein content in petals of four cut flowers were increased at a peak respectively, and then declined, while the malondialdehyde content was increased all the way. With four cut flowers, declining rate of reducing sugar content and soluble protein content of all treatment were significantly higher than that of their controls respectively, while the increasing rate of malondialdehyde content of all treatment was significantly low- er than that of their controls respectively. In addition, vase solution II greatly prolonged the vase life of chrysanthemum, carnation and rose, and played an important role on vase life of gladiolus as well. Thus, 3% sucrose + 250 mg / L 8 - HQ + 300 mg / L citric acid treatment was the optimal vase solution to improve the keeping quality of cut flowers. The content of the reducing sugar, soluble protein and malondialdehyde content in the petals can be regarded as physiological parameters to indicate vase life of these four cut flowers.
